Adopted rule summary:

HPD rules govern the requirements for applications for tax exemptions pursuant to Real Property Tax Law Section 485-x (“ANNY Program Benefits”). This amendment reverts to previous best practices under prior versions of this tax benefit program and fixes issues with the timeline of the application process for ANNY Program Benefits for homeownership projects. Specifically, the amendment allows homeownership projects to file their ANNY Program Benefits applications if at least fifty percent of all units have been sold, in order to make it easier for such projects to meet the application filing deadline of one year from completion of construction, provided that proofs of sale for all units in the project are submitted before ANNY Program Benefits are granted.
